DirectRooms.com – Head to Belfast for Spring Fair During 16 to 17 April 2011

Visitors are expected to turn up in their thousands for a unique festival in Belfast dedicated to the sights and sounds of spring that will also be raising awareness for the importance of the city’s parks and green areas, DirectRooms.com reports.

Over the weekend of 16th and 17th April 2011, Spring Fair is designed to take attendees back to nature by interacting with local wildlife and learning about the importance of protecting and maintaining the habitats of animals. Activities for children include the chance to feed new born lambs, horse rides and see displays of agility from birds of prey.

Experts will be on site to educate children in ways to sustain the environment while also explaining how to identify rare breeds of animals and insect varieties. Along with the nature displays people are able to participate in archery, climbing, maypole dancing and caving and see stalls dedicated to all kinds of craftsmanship.

Visitors checked into hotels Belfast will also be arriving in the thousands for the Spring Flower Show at the same time which consists of beautiful prize winning blooms and gardening demonstrations.

All the activities run in the afternoon from 13:30 to 17:30 at Barnett Demesne and Malone House and admission is free for all ages.
